Main Page | Directories | Namespace List | Class Hierarchy | Alphabetical List | Class List | File List | Class Members | File Members | Related Pages | Examples

t3lib_sqlengine_resultobj Class Reference

List of all members.

Public Member Functions

 sql_num_rows ()
 Counting number of rows.
 sql_fetch_assoc ()
 Fetching next row in result array.
 sql_fetch_row ()
 Fetching next row, numerical indices.
 sql_data_seek ($pointer)
 Seeking position in result.
 sql_field_type ()
 [Describe function...]

Public Attributes

 $result = array()
 $TYPO3_DBAL_handlerType = ''
 $TYPO3_DBAL_tableList = ''

Member Function Documentation

t3lib_sqlengine_resultobj::sql_data_seek pointer  ) 
 

Seeking position in result.

Parameters:
integer Position pointer.
Returns:
boolean Returns true on success

Definition at line 876 of file class.t3lib_sqlengine.php.

References $a.

00876                                     {
00877       reset($this->result);
00878       for ($a=0;$a<$pointer;$a++)   {
00879          next($this->result);
00880       }
00881       return TRUE;
00882    }

t3lib_sqlengine_resultobj::sql_fetch_assoc  ) 
 

Fetching next row in result array.

Returns:
array Associative array

Definition at line 847 of file class.t3lib_sqlengine.php.

Referenced by sql_fetch_row().

00847                               {
00848       $row = current($this->result);
00849       next($this->result);
00850       return $row;
00851    }

t3lib_sqlengine_resultobj::sql_fetch_row  ) 
 

Fetching next row, numerical indices.

Returns:
array Numerical array

Definition at line 858 of file class.t3lib_sqlengine.php.

References sql_fetch_assoc().

00858                               {
00859       $resultRow = $this->sql_fetch_assoc();
00860 
00861       if (is_array($resultRow))  {
00862          $numArray = array();
00863          foreach($resultRow as $value) {
00864             $numArray[]=$value;
00865          }
00866          return $numArray;
00867       }
00868    }

t3lib_sqlengine_resultobj::sql_field_type  ) 
 

[Describe function...]

Returns:
[type] ...

Definition at line 889 of file class.t3lib_sqlengine.php.

00889                               {
00890       return '';
00891    }

t3lib_sqlengine_resultobj::sql_num_rows  ) 
 

Counting number of rows.

Returns:
integer

Definition at line 838 of file class.t3lib_sqlengine.php.

00838                            {
00839       return count($this->result);
00840    }


Member Data Documentation

t3lib_sqlengine_resultobj::$result = array()
 

Definition at line 827 of file class.t3lib_sqlengine.php.

t3lib_sqlengine_resultobj::$TYPO3_DBAL_handlerType = ''
 

Definition at line 829 of file class.t3lib_sqlengine.php.

t3lib_sqlengine_resultobj::$TYPO3_DBAL_tableList = ''
 

Definition at line 830 of file class.t3lib_sqlengine.php.


The documentation for this class was generated from the following file:
Generated on Sun Oct 3 01:07:12 2004 for TYPO3core 3.7.0 dev by  doxygen 1.3.8-20040913